This was the level of the July 2017 flash flood. Dozens of properties were flooded along the reach of the creek. Several residents were evacuated from their homes. Several bridges and roads were inundated from Choconut, PA to Vestal, NY
FEMA flood insurance risk maps indicate that this stream level on the gauge marks the 0.2% (500-year) floodplain. Your property is at risk for flooding during a near record flood event. A 500-year flood is a flood that has a 0.2 percent chance of occurring in any year.
FEMA flood insurance risk maps indicate that this stream level on the gauge marks the 1% (100-year) floodplain. Your property is at risk for flooding during a major flood event. A 100-year flood is a flood that has a 1 percent chance of occurring in any year.
Widespread significant flooding begins from the PA State Line to downtown Vestal. Evacuations and water rescues have occurred in the past above this level. Bridges on Kellum Rd., Glenwood Rd., West Hill Rd., are likely to be flooded.
Flooding of properties and homes increases on Richards Ave., Kintner Estates, Glenwood Road, Coleman Street, West Hill Road, Grand Ave., and Sunset Ave.
Water floods into the natural floodplain near the gauge. Downstream flooding occurs at Richards Avenue Park, Vestal Center Park, and may reach backyards of residences closest to the river at around 9 feet.
Officials begin local notification of rising waters. Flood preparedness functions begin.

The NWS-defined flood stage for Choconut Creek near Choconut is 8.5 feet. Action stage begins at 8 feet. Moderate flooding starts at 9.5 feet, and major flooding at 10.5 feet.
